Implement Exclusion Procedures



Examining and sealing entry factors is the initial step in rodent-proofing your outside space; currently you'll do something about it by carrying out exclusion measures.

Begin by setting up door sweeps on all exterior doors to avoid rodents from squeezing with gaps. Seal cracks and crevices with weather-resistant sealer, focusing on locations where utility pipelines enter your home.

Use wire mesh to cover vents and smokeshafts, guaranteeing they're securely attached. Cut tree branches and vegetation away from your home to get rid of potential bridges for rats to access your roof covering.

Furthermore, take into consideration setting up steel blinking around the base of your home to avoid burrowing. Store fire wood at least 18 inches off the ground and far from your house.

Maintain trash in tightly secured containers, and promptly clean up any type of spilled birdseed or pet dog food. By carrying out these exclusion procedures, you can dramatically decrease the chance of rats invading your outside area.
